Kinn is best known for the medieval church, Kinnaspelet and great hiking opportunities. There are also fantastic paddling opportunities from Kinn. The nature on this green island in the far west of the sea is quite unique. Here you get a wide view and the sunset on the horizon.

History
The island of Kinn has a rich history with the old stone church, Kinnakyrkja from the 12th century as a highlight. The legends about the Heilag people and Saint Sunniva, who came across the sea from the west and landed on Selja and Kinn, have always made an impression on people here. The well-known sailing mark " Kinnaklova " is in the west of the island. On the island is the old trading town in Kinnasundet from the 17th century. This DNT cabin was originally a schoolhouse. There was a school here from the 1920s.
